
Pasta Chips
Want to try a fun new option for a side dish? Why not fry up some pasta chips.

Ingredients
1 package rigatoni pasta, cooked
2 tbsp olive oil
2 tbsp southwestern fajitas seasoning
2 tbsp grated parmesan cheese
For the dip:
1/4 cup tahini sauce
1/3 cup Ranch dressing
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1/4 cup sour cream
2 tbsp ketchup
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
1
Divide the pasta in half and drizzle with olive oil and sprinkle with seasoning (to taste) and the grated parmesan cheese. Toss to coat everything.
2
Place the seasoned pasta into the basket of your air fryer and cook for 12 minutes at 400 degree’s. Be sure to stir the pasta every 3 minutes to make sure it crisps up evenly.
3
Remove from the air fryer when crispy, if needed adjust fry times to adjust crispiness.
4
To make the sauce, combine the tahini sauce, Ranch dressing, mayonnaise, sour cream, ketchup, salt and pepper in a large bowl, mix everything together to combine.
5
Serve the sauce with the pasta chips.
